본문 바로가기
728x90

코딩이러닝51

[Java 프로그래밍 초급] 객체지향 기초개념 (2) ✨ 이 글은 [ 코드프레소 Java 웹 개발 체험단 활동 ] 내용입니다 ✨ 💜 코드프레소 이러닝 강의 수강 중 - Java 프로그래밍 초급 💜 😎 아래의 링크를 통해 프리미엄 IT 교육 서비스, 코드프레소를 확인해보세요 😎 https://www.codepresso.kr/ 프리미엄 IT 교육 서비스 - 코드프레소 www.codepresso.kr 메소드(Method) 객체는 속성과 행위를 갖고 있고, 메소드는 객체의 행위를 정의한다 메소드는 함수(function)과 거의 유사하다 input과 output이 존재하며 특정 작업을 수행한다 메소드는 특정 객체에 포함되어 있다 독립적으로 존재하지 않는다 함수(funtion) 특정한 작업을 수행하기 위한 코드들의 집합 특정 작업의 코드들을 모듈화하여 필요한 경우 호.. 2022. 1. 20.
[Java 프로그래밍 초급] 객체지향 기초개념 (1) ✨ 이 글은 [ 코드프레소 Java 웹 개발 체험단 활동 ] 내용입니다 ✨ 💜 코드프레소 이러닝 강의 수강 중 - Java 프로그래밍 초급 💜 😎 아래의 링크를 통해 프리미엄 IT 교육 서비스, 코드프레소를 확인해보세요 😎 https://www.codepresso.kr/ 프리미엄 IT 교육 서비스 - 코드프레소 www.codepresso.kr SW 개발 방법론 SW는 매우 복잡하고 점점 거대해지고 있다 요구사항 대로 동작하는 SW를 정해진 기간/예산 안에 만드는 것이 어렵다 Software Crisis(1968) : SW를 개발하는 족족 실패하던 시기,,,🥶 어떻게 하면 큰 규모의 SW를 잘 만들고 관리할 수 있을까? -> SW 개발 방법론 SW 개발은 일련의 과정의 연속들로 이루어진다 요구사항 수집 요.. 2022. 1. 20.
[실무자가 알려주는 Git 활용한 프로젝트 관리] Git 브랜치 활용 ✨ 이 글은 [ 코드프레소 Java 웹 개발 체험단 활동 ] 내용입니다 ✨ 💜 코드프레소 이러닝 강의 수강 중 - 실무자가 알려주는 Git 활용한 프로젝트 관리 💜 😎 아래의 링크를 통해 프리미엄 IT 교육 서비스, 코드프레소를 확인해보세요 😎 https://www.codepresso.kr/ 프리미엄 IT 교육 서비스 - 코드프레소 www.codepresso.kr 브랜치가 왜 필요할까요? 소프트웨어는 지속적으로 변경된다 소프트웨어에 대한 변경은 개발 진행중이나 개발이 완료되어 사용중인 제품에서 발생하는 문제점을 해결하거나 개선하기 위해 발생할 수 있다 브랜치 활용 전략 Git을 이용한 브랜치 활용 방식은 개인/조직마다 다를 수 있다 브랜치 활용 전략은 소스코드의 효율적인 관리를 위해 프로젝트의 모든 리스.. 2022. 1. 16.
[실무자가 알려주는 Git 활용한 프로젝트 관리] Git 브랜치의 이해 ✨ 이 글은 [ 코드프레소 Java 웹 개발 체험단 활동 ] 내용입니다 ✨ 💜 코드프레소 이러닝 강의 수강 중 - 실무자가 알려주는 Git 활용한 프로젝트 관리 💜 😎 아래의 링크를 통해 프리미엄 IT 교육 서비스, 코드프레소를 확인해보세요 😎 https://www.codepresso.kr/ 프리미엄 IT 교육 서비스 - 코드프레소 www.codepresso.kr 브랜치(branch) 원래 코드에 영향을 주지 않고 개발을 진행할 수 있는 공간 본래의 소스코드로 부터 파생한 독립적인 작업 공간 최신 커밋을 가리키는 일종의 포인터이다 쉽게 만들고 없앨 수 있을만큼 매우 가볍다 생성, 이동, 병합(merge)이 매우 쉽다 master 브랜치 Git은 기본적으로 master 브랜치를 생성한다 아마 main 브랜.. 2022. 1. 16.
[처음 시작하는 Java 프로그래밍] 반복문 ✨ 이 글은 [ 코드프레소 Java 웹 개발 체험단 활동 ] 내용입니다 ✨ 💜 코드프레소 이러닝 강의 수강 중 - 처음 시작하는 Java 프로그래밍 💜 😎 아래의 링크를 통해 프리미엄 IT 교육 서비스, 코드프레소를 확인해보세요 😎 https://www.codepresso.kr/ 프리미엄 IT 교육 서비스 - 코드프레소 www.codepresso.kr 제어문 (Control Flow Statement) 자바 프로그램은 기본적으로 위에서 아래로 순차적으로 실행된다 프로그램의 실행 순서를 제어할 수 있다 조건에 따라 실행 코드를 분기 - 조건문(Conditional Statement) 특정 코드를 반복해서 실행 - 반복문(Loop Statement) 반복문(Iteration Statement) 특정 코드 집.. 2022. 1. 14.
[처음 시작하는 Java 프로그래밍] 배열 ✨ 이 글은 [ 코드프레소 Java 웹 개발 체험단 활동 ] 내용입니다 ✨ 💜 코드프레소 이러닝 강의 수강 중 - 처음 시작하는 Java 프로그래밍 💜 😎 아래의 링크를 통해 프리미엄 IT 교육 서비스, 코드프레소를 확인해보세요 😎 https://www.codepresso.kr/ 프리미엄 IT 교육 서비스 - 코드프레소 www.codepresso.kr 자료구조 (Data Structure) 숫자형, 문자형 데이터는 하나의 변수에 1개의 데이터를 저장한다 프로그램에서 사용되는 데이터는 복잡할 수 있다 따라서 관련있는 데이터들을 그룹화하여 저장하고 처리하는 방법을 고민하였다! 자료구조는 관련 있는 데이터들을 그룹화하여 하나의 변수에 저장한다 그룹화된 데이터들에 대한 추가적인 연산도 제공한다 Java 배열 (.. 2022. 1. 14.
728x90